DEAR DEIDRE: AFTER being with my partner for more than a decade, our relationship ended with an horrific fight three years ago.

We had our ups and downs, but he became distant and angry and took his work and family problems out on me.

Having celebrated my 50th birthday at the weekend, I’m so angry that I am now left in this position – alone.

As a woman, I don’t want to go through the dating scene because it is horrendous.

But I cannot believe that this is now it for me.

I know this must sound muddled because, while I do love being by myself, I don’t want it to be for ever – and not meet someone new.

I never thought that I would end up as this sad, lonely person.

DEIDRE SAYS: It is tough to find yourself alone after years of being in a couple.

Get into sports or volunteering.

The more friends you make, the better the chance one of them will turn out to be right for you.

Check out meetup.com which shows events and clubs in your local area.
